做网站的专业叫啥wordpress定制分类
做网站的专业叫啥,wordpress定制分类,网站怎么更新文章,seo诊断工具网站音频解密与文件转换工具#xff1a;qmcdump技术解析与应用指南 【免费下载链接】qmcdump 一个简单的QQ音乐解码#xff08;qmcflac/qmc0/qmc3 转 flac/mp3#xff09;#xff0c;仅为个人学习参考用。 项目地址: https://gitcode.com/gh_mirrors/qm/qmcdump
在数字音…音频解密与文件转换工具qmcdump技术解析与应用指南【免费下载链接】qmcdump一个简单的QQ音乐解码qmcflac/qmc0/qmc3 转 flac/mp3仅为个人学习参考用。项目地址: https://gitcode.com/gh_mirrors/qm/qmcdump在数字音乐收藏过程中用户常常遇到特定格式的加密音频文件无法跨平台播放的问题。这些经过特殊加密处理的音频文件如.qmcflac、.qmc0等格式通常只能在专用客户端中使用限制了用户对个人音乐资源的自由支配。加密音频处理的核心挑战在于如何在保护知识产权的同时为合法用户提供格式转换的可能性。qmcdump作为一款专注于音频解密与格式转换的开源工具通过本地处理方式解决了这一矛盾既保障了文件处理的安全性又实现了加密音频的跨平台使用。核心价值本地解密技术的突破传统加密音频处理方式存在两大痛点依赖云端转换服务带来的隐私泄露风险以及专业音频编辑软件操作复杂、学习成本高的问题。qmcdump通过以下技术特性实现了突破处理方式隐私保护操作复杂度格式支持处理效率云端转换服务低文件需上传低有限依赖网络专业音频软件高高广泛中等qmcdump工具高本地处理低针对性强高qmcdump的核心优势体现在三个方面首先全程本地处理确保音频文件不会泄露到第三方服务器其次命令行操作模式简化了处理流程无需图形界面即可完成转换最后多格式支持覆盖了主流加密音频格式包括qmcflac、qmc0和qmc3等。场景化应用从单一文件到批量处理环境准备与安装部署在使用qmcdump前需完成以下准备工作确保系统已安装gcc编译器和make工具链通过版本控制工具获取源代码git clone https://gitcode.com/gh_mirrors/qm/qmcdump cd qmcdump执行编译流程# 快速构建可执行文件 make # 可选系统级安装需管理员权限 sudo make install编译完成后当前目录将生成名为qmcdump的可执行文件。若选择系统级安装可直接在终端中使用qmcdump命令。单一文件转换操作针对单个加密音频文件qmcdump提供简洁的命令格式# 基础转换语法 qmcdump [输入文件路径] [输出文件路径] # 示例1将qmcflac转换为标准flac格式 qmcdump ./music/encrypted.qmcflac ./decrypted/music.flac # 示例2将qmc0格式转换为mp3格式 qmcdump ~/downloads/song.qmc0 ~/music/song.mp3注意若未指定输出文件路径工具将自动在输入文件相同目录下生成转换后的文件默认使用标准格式扩展名如.flac或.mp3。批量处理功能应用当需要处理整个目录的加密音频时qmcdump的批量转换功能可显著提升效率# 批量转换整个目录 qmcdump [源目录路径] [目标目录路径] # 实际应用示例 qmcdump ./encrypted_music ./decrypted_library批量处理过程中工具将保持原有的目录结构并自动识别目录中所有支持的加密格式文件。对于已转换的文件qmcdump会跳过处理实现断点续传功能。技术解析音频解密的数据流程qmcdump的解密过程遵循标准化的数据处理流程主要包含三个阶段1. 文件格式识别工具首先通过分析文件头部特征Header Signature来确定加密类型。不同格式的加密文件具有独特的标识信息例如qmcflac格式以特定字节序列起始。这一阶段对应源代码中crypt.cpp文件的格式检测模块通过特征匹配算法快速定位加密方案。2. 密钥生成与数据解密根据识别的加密类型系统调用相应的解密算法模块。核心解密逻辑采用对称加密算法的逆过程通过预定义的密钥表和位运算操作将加密数据还原为原始音频流。这一过程完全在内存中完成避免了临时文件的创建提升了处理效率和安全性。3. 音频格式重构解密后的原始音频数据需要按照标准格式进行重新封装。qmcdump根据文件扩展名自动选择目标格式添加必要的元数据Metadata和文件头信息最终生成符合行业标准的音频文件。这一阶段由directory.cpp中的格式处理函数实现确保输出文件的兼容性。扩展实践自动化与合规使用构建自动化工作流通过结合系统任务调度工具可实现加密音频的自动处理。以下是一个基于cron的自动化脚本示例#!/bin/bash # 自动监控下载目录并转换新文件 WATCH_DIR$HOME/Downloads DEST_DIR$HOME/Music/decrypted # 查找最近24小时内修改的qmc文件并转换 find $WATCH_DIR -name *.qmc* -mtime -1 | while read file; do qmcdump $file $DEST_DIR/$(basename ${file%.*}).mp3 done将此脚本添加到crontab中可实现每日自动处理新下载的加密音频文件。合法使用与版权保护使用qmcdump时用户必须遵守以下原则仅对个人拥有合法使用权的音频文件进行处理不得将转换后的文件用于商业用途或非法传播尊重音乐作品的知识产权遵守相关法律法规工具开发者明确声明qmcdump仅用于个人学习参考使用者需自行承担因不当使用可能产生的法律责任。常见问题解决权限错误处理若执行时出现Permission denied错误需为可执行文件添加执行权限chmod x qmcdump格式识别失败当工具无法识别文件格式时建议检查文件扩展名是否正确验证文件完整性排除损坏可能确认文件是否为qmcdump支持的加密格式输出文件验证转换完成后可通过文件大小和播放测试进行验证qmcflac转flac文件大小应基本保持一致qmc0/qmc3转mp3文件大小通常会有所减小但音质应保持原始水平qmcdump作为一款专注于解决加密音频转换问题的工具通过简洁的命令行接口和高效的本地处理能力为用户提供了合法合规的音频格式转换方案。无论是个人音乐收藏管理还是音频文件的跨平台使用qmcdump都展现出显著的技术优势和实用价值。【免费下载链接】qmcdump一个简单的QQ音乐解码qmcflac/qmc0/qmc3 转 flac/mp3仅为个人学习参考用。项目地址: https://gitcode.com/gh_mirrors/qm/qmcdump创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考